Rob, if we could get a "ringtone" or sound effects pack (in addition to more soundtracks!) that'd be phenomenal. If anyone needs justification, just show them the shut-up-and-take-my-money levels of interest in the excellent sound and music design of ME3.

I'd want to see a few different types of sounds:

* User interface sounds: power upgrade sound, "press start" menu sound, galaxy map user interface sounds, power wheel enter/exit sounds, etc. I'll also take this moment to beg for a "Level Up" sound from the original Mass Effect.
* Enemy sounds: a Banshee scream, Marauder cyber-chatter, Geth chatter, Cerberus "damn it!" (:-P), etc.
* Power activation sounds: Singularity, Slam, Nova, Charge, Reave, etc. etc. etc…so good.
* Weapon sounds: while potentially difficult to adapt for a short sound effect/ringtone, guns sound really, really good in ME3. Also, turret fire sounds, stun baton activation sound, omniblade activation sounds(!!!), grenade sound, Bonus if you include a mix of the gun sound effects from the part at the end of Rannoch.
* Reaper sounds: the awesome laser sound, a reaper "cry", etc.
* Character dialog: EDI's "that was a joke", some Joker one-liners, "Hackett out", Garrus's "calibrations" line, James's "holy ****" one-liner, etc. Bonus: Matriarch Aethya and Aria T'Loak one-liners.
* Miscellaneous: the "foghorn sunrise" sound, used in Mass Effect trailers.

Also, please consider releasing some of the shorter musical loops as ringtones, like the looping menu music, etc. Thanks for your time, Rob.
